Tampere Market Hall (Tampereen Kauppahalli) is not just a market, but a true landmark and the heart of urban life in Tampere, Finland. Located in the very center of the city, between Hämeenkatu and Hallituskatu, this indoor market proudly holds the title of the largest market hall in all of Scandinavia. This historical site attracts both locals and tourists with its authentic atmosphere and variety of goods.

The market building is impressive in size: the total floor area of the hall is 2,100 square meters, and the volume of the space reaches about 18,500 cubic meters. Inside this spacious complex, there are as many as 174 retail outlets offering visitors a wide range of products. Here you can find fresh local produce, delicacies, souvenirs, and much more, making it an important commercial hub for the city.
Cafes and restaurants hold a special place in the Tampere Market Hall—about 40% of all retail space is dedicated to them. This makes the market not only a place for shopping but also a popular spot for gastronomic discoveries. Among the many establishments, the restaurant "4 Vuodenaikaa" ("Four Seasons") is particularly loved by both locals and guests of Tampere, known for its delicious dishes prepared with fresh ingredients.
